Tinder

Mom told us not to play with fire, I don't know why she would bother.. we kids are too simple to put forth any effort into building one anyway. In a generation of instant electronic gratification we seem to prefer the fleeting warmth of a quick match and enjoying the flimsy flame of hasty relief that it brings. Eyes blazing as our scorching desires dwindle and turn to smoke. "Wow, that was hot!". Strike another match. This one will light the fire to keep me warm at night. Oh how it burns...Will I ever learn?
